    The best way I can describe Anthem as a video game is that it really isn't one. It's a truly barebones experience by all standards that I had little to no enjoyment playing whatsoever. Hating on this game is popular, but I actually played a significant amount it and can safely say that every criticism you've likely heard about it is absolutely true.

    For starters, the story is a mess that doesn't make much sense. Nothing is really ever expanded on, nor is a cohesive narrative or game world ever present at any point. Something about the Anthem of Creation and cataclysms and invaders, etc. The characters are also lacking in depth and personality. They all, including the protagonist, desperately try to be funny but rarely if ever achieve that goal. Dialogue options make a compulsory appearance, but it has absolutely no effect on the conversations at all and only serves to waste your time.

    You get quests at an empty, lifeless hub world that you have to slowly travel in first-person for some reason. This is where you talk to people who aren't interesting about things you don't care about and take on missions that aren't fun. It honestly serves as a buffer to the gameplay, especially with the gargantuan load times you suffer in transition.

    Speaking of gameplay, it isn't very fun. Missions are, as I said, barebones. If you've ever played a patrol mission in the Destiny series, picture those as every mission, main or side, in the entire game. You have essentially 3 options: Fly to place and kill things, fly to place and defend static area while killing things, or fly to place and kill things while collecting materials they drop. That's literally it. That's every mission in the game. Period.

    And the gameplay itself gets old really quick. The novelty of piloting your Javelin suit evaporates within the first few hours. Turns out being Space Iron Man isn't fun when you have nothing to do. There are only a handful of enemy types in the entire game and only two different heavy miniboss enemies. You'll get very tired of killing the same giant shield-bearers over and over again. Combat also feels disjointed. Unlike other shooter-looters, enemies don't really react to getting shot. You more or less just fire at them until their health meter goes down then they drop dead. Games like Destiny and Warframe may be grindy, but at least they feel good to play. Anthem does not.

    The loot in Anthem is likewise underwhelming. In fact, it feels completely inconsequential. One of the most important things about being a loot-driven game is to make it exciting to get better loot. All "loot" in Anthem looks pretty much the same, from weapons to Javelin parts. Really you're just combing though a post-mission menu equipping the thing with the highest number. There's no variety, excitement, or fun to the loot. In fact, the entire loot system feels like it was tacked on as an afterthought in order to extend player engagement.

    Graphically, Anthem isn't great. The lush jungles look nice at first, but textures were always popping in at a distance and constantly reminding me of the broken nature of this game. I played on an original PS4 so maybe it looked better on a Pro, but I can only judge it based on how I experienced it. Also, that lush jungle is the environment for the entire game. Outside of some caves and ruins, there are no other biomes to speak of.

    I will say that I did have some fun with the heavy Javelin type (Colossus I believe). It was fairly fun to to used my hulking frame to pound enemies into the dirt. I felt powerful and it was reasonably satisfying given the static overall feel of the combat. But that's as far as my enjoyment went.

    Anthem is an early access game that was sold at a premium $60 price. It's an embarrassment to video games, an embarrassment to EA, and and embarrassment to Bioware. Apparently it was in the conception stage for 5 years and only actually worked on for a single year before being dumped out on us in the shape it was in. Not that it's improved much since launch. Bioware literally had to cancel the entire post-launch roadmap because they were unable to fix the game in a timely manner.

    Some people are hoping for a Final Fantasy XIV-style rebirth, but I am not. FFXIV was led by a talented lead designer with a passionate team of of developers. Bioware has no creative direction or drive to fix anything in Anthem and it shows. At the time of this writing, it's been almost two years since launch and nothing has improved. Anthem will likely go down in history as a testament to mismanaged game development, corporate deceit, and the absolute failure of live-service games. And honestly, it deserves to do so.

    At times Anthem is enjoyable, it is just unfortunate that those times are few and far between.

    Anthem is effectively a four-person, instanced; squad shooter. The bulk of the action takes place within instanced missions, or strongholds (dungeons). These can be fun, especially on higher difficulty levels; however the objectives consistently boil down to 1. Kill everything, 2. Fetch this, or 3. Kill everything & fetch this. This is not uncommon, but other games in this genre try to present these objectives in an engaging way. In Anthem, they are presented lazily.

    This all gets tiresome quickly.

    Yes - flying in a robotic suit, firing missiles, hitting combos; and shooting machine guns is fun.. but there is no real depth here.

    There is little incentive to play at higher difficult levels other than for thechallenge. In other looter shooters you are rewarded by the increased chance of better gear or loot; that isn’t the case here.

    The game is also disjointed. The menu layout is unintuitive, there are long load times, you have to return to Fort Tarsis (your base of operation) far too frequently, you cant swap equipment in-mission, sound stops and starts in big firefights, the javelin controls are a bit peculiar (there is no ascent option, you have to move forwards if you want to fly up; thus prepare to hit a lot of walls). I could go on. Basically, all of these frustrations pull you out of what could have been a good game.. if there was any game there to have. This is just a lot of interesting sci-fi shooter ideas, poorly executed.

    There are some bizarre design choices. Fort Tarsis (your base of operation) is purely singleplayer. You have to actively travel to (load) a separate social area to engage with other players. Why not integrate the two ala Destiny?

    Customisation is good, and there are a number of components, weapons, grenades etc.. which shows potential for customising a build. However, you are still effectively pigeon holed into a specific part of the class spectrum (Rogue: Interceptor, Mage: Storm, Tank: Gladiator, Generalist: Ranger).

    All in all - this feels more like a demo than a fully fleshed out game. The fact that this was released at full price is shocking.

    I give this game a 4 because it can be entertaining (and I only paid £5 for it), but it needs a complete re-work.
